Belmar to Trenton

Updated: 31 May 2026

The trip from Belmar to Trenton covers approximately 70 kilometers across central New Jersey. Driving is the most practical method, typically taking about 90 minutes via I-195 West. Public transit is possible but requires multiple transfers, making it less convenient for most travelers. Trenton is the state capital and home to significant historical sites, including the Old Barracks Museum. Plan your travel to avoid rush hour congestion on the major highways leading into the city.

Total Distance: 70 km driving, 62 km straight-line.

Things to Do in Trenton
1
New Jersey State House
The historic seat of the state government. It offers guided tours of the legislative chambers.
2
Old Barracks Museum
A colonial-era military barracks that played a key role in the American Revolution. It is a must-see for history buffs.
3
Trenton City Museum
Located in Ellarslie Mansion, it showcases local history and art. It is set in a beautiful park.
4
War Memorial
A historic venue hosting concerts and cultural events. It is a beautiful example of neoclassical architecture.
